Transaction 75a3869ec180be234b1cfb3602cdd6fb5d65c9b99ba984809adab075cfe6bf4e
1 Input
1 Output
-
75a3869ec180be234b1cfb3602cdd6fb5d65c9b99ba984809adab075cfe6bf4e:0
- value
- 1046938
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3634157118ef6cd3eacf788b00c4a1d74592a5a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15wbtChb2UPwceTujCJqjfEskQLYJJ54fc